FInEx AmeriEuro - Panel 5 Finance on the Fly - Agility as a Competitive Edge

Don’t miss this transformative session from the FinEx AmeriEuro Summit 2025! Our panel, ” Finance on the Fly - Agility as a Competitive Edge,” brought together some stellar finance leaders to explore how agility is reshaping the role of the CFO.

Meet our panelists:

Andrew Lee, CFO at Scythe Robotics

Dan Crumb, CFO of the Kansas City Chiefs

Jesper Hybholt Sorensen, CFO at Mambu

Paul Barnhurst, “The FP&A Guy”

Our host:

Steve Rosvold, Chief Learning Officer at CFO.University

Our panelists embark on a journey beyond the numbers and traditional roles to explore the magic of agility. In today’s fast-paced world, adaptability isn’t just a skill—it’s a necessity for success in the CFO realm. Our panel dove deep into how agility can transform financial strategies, enhance decision-making, and drive growth.

The critical lesson? CFOs need to pivot quickly, foster innovation, and leverage data not just to survive but to thrive. From optimizing processes to driving top-line growth, agile CFOs are setting the stage for future financial success.

Agility fuels competitive advantage, enabling CFOs to lead with confidence and foresight. It’s time to harness this power and revolutionize your approach!

Here some quotes from the presentation that capture the key concepts discussed:

“In today’s rapidly changing business landscape, financial agility isn’t optional. It’s essential for survival and success.” - Jess Dewell

“Our goal was to basically take any process or system that wasn’t working very well and make it better, like, quickly, just as fast as we could.” - Andrew Lee

“We put that in place. First week, we got our first few things done. Secondly, we got our next two things done.” - Andrew Lee

“If you put in the time, you start to learn the data. You can get the reporting. The systems will come in time, but a lot of it is just using the tools you have to be more agile and figure out how to do things.” - Paul Barnhurst

“We have a CRM system. We have other systems that we use for data visualization. We have our ERP. We have a separate budgeting and forecasting system. So weaving and tying all these together so that we get really good information…” - Dan Crumb

“You earn the right to be a business partner by being agile. If people won’t invite you to the meeting, if you’re holding everything up, if you’re the… anchor on all the decision making, you’re not gonna be invited.” - Steve Rosvold

“It’s the people that mentioned that we need to think about. This is where we need to be curious about how to deliver more insight or how to deliver more foresight.” - Jesper Hybholt Sorensen

“Think like you own this business. That way you’re more connected to outcomes. You’re going to make better decisions if you think like the owner.” - Dan Crumb

“We shouldn’t focus our time on the green (well functioning) ones here, the one where everything was positive. Also, we shouldn’t focus our time on the one where everything was negative (investment too great). Our opportunity was improving at the margins.” - Jesper Hybholt Sorensen on analyzing the sales pipeline and forecasting sales

“We were able to, start tracking in the system through, you know, a bunch of just check boxes basically that were indicators that we’re getting closer and closer to a signed deal.” - Andrew Lee

“Had one person… take notes. One person make sure we’re on time in the agenda. One person report out to the company what we had done the prior week and what we’re going to do in the next week.” - Andrew Lee

” A agreat way to knock out a ton of stuff, really, the most important stuff, relatively quicklys with an Agile ‘Fix It,’ team.” - Andrew Lee

“Agile ... how we move and act quickly while staying responsible to the business” - Steve Rosvold
